Is Your Practice Audit-Ready? 7 Steps That Protect Dentists

“It wasn’t intentional—but it changed everything.”

Out of $3.5 million in claims over six and a half years, just $17,899.57 was deemed improper.

The result?
He received a 24-month federal prison sentence.

In this powerful episode of Dental Office Rescue, Linda Kane sits down with Roy Shelburne, DDS — a nationally recognized speaker on dental documentation, billing, and compliance — to share the story behind his mission.

And that mission is deeply personal.

“I’m passionate about being the last dental professional who goes to prison for things they didn’t know or understand. Ignorance is no excuse. I’m the crash dummy. I’m the one that went through the process and learned the hard way that there are things we can do to protect and defend our practices.”

This isn’t a story about intentional fraud.

It’s a story about what happens when documentation systems, compliance protocols, and audit processes aren’t in place — even when you believe you’re doing everything right.

It’s about what you didn’t know…
And why knowing now changes everything.

How Small Documentation Gaps Turn Into Major Legal Exposure

One of the most important lessons from Roy’s experience is this:

There is no such thing as an innocent mistake in the eyes of the law.

Roy explains the legal concept of “blind disregard.”
If a practice repeatedly submits claims without a system to identify and correct errors, that can legally be interpreted as intent — even if the mistakes were never deliberate.

That means:

  • Not reviewing clinical notes before claims are submitted
  • Not signing documentation properly
  • Not having internal audits in place
  • Inconsistent coding practices
  • Waiving copays or misreporting fees

All of these create risk — especially if your practice accepts any form of government reimbursement (Medicaid, Medicare, federal employee plans, ACA plans, military dependents).

In today’s environment, insurance companies are using AI to identify outliers. If your coding patterns fall outside statistical norms, it can trigger scrutiny.

It’s no longer just about whether something was intentional.

It’s about whether you had systems in place.

The 7-Step Compliance System Every Dental Practice Needs

Roy outlines a structured, mandated 7-step compliance program that removes “blind disregard” from the equation and protects your practice.

Here’s what it includes:

  1. Commit to implementing an audit system
  2. Establish clear documentation and billing standards
  3. Assign a compliance leader in your practice
  4. Train your team consistently (not just once)
  5. Create open feedback channels between team and doctor
  6. Identify errors and implement corrective systems
  7. Remove team members who refuse to meet standards after training

This isn’t about fear.
It’s about protection.

When documentation tells the beginning, middle, and end of the story…
When notes are signed…
When coding reflects exactly what was done…
When systems exist to catch errors…

You dramatically reduce risk.

Why “I Didn’t Know” Isn’t a Defense

Roy says it clearly:

Ignorance is no excuse.

Many dentists believe, “That would never happen to me.”

Roy believed that too.

His practice had strong patient relationships. He was busy. He wasn’t trying to cheat the system. In fact, the error rate determined by the government was less than one-tenth of one percent.

But without a compliance system to identify and correct errors, the legal interpretation changed everything.

The takeaway?

The choice to implement systems — or ignore them — is still yours.
